前继节点:某个节点的前继节点,是指比该节点小的所有节点中的最大的一个节点。如在上图中,比节点“8”小的节点有很多个,但是最大的一个节点为“7”,那么节点“7”则为节点“8”的前继节点; 后继节点:某个节点的后继节点,是指比该节点大的所有节点中的最小的一个节点。如在上如中,比节点“1”大的节...
/// 找到node的前继节点publicstaticNodegetPerviousNode(Node node){if(node==null){returnnode;}if(node.left!=null){// 若有左子树,那么前继节点就是左子树中,最右的节点returngetRightMost(node.left);}else{// 若没有右子树,那么沿着node的父节点查找,直至parent.right = nodeNode parent=node.parent;...
定位前任和后继节点 我有一种用于在二进制搜索树中获取继承者和前任节点的方法,但我有一些问题在我的代码中找到错误。请说我使用以下键添加节点:"C","B", 和"K"。如果我打印了二进制搜索树的内容,我会得到以下输出: "C""some data 1" "B""some data 2" "K""some data 3" 当我添加时"B"它显然没...
1、若该节点有左子树,那么其前继节点必然是左子树中,最右的节点 2、若该节点node没有左子树,则沿着parent节点往上找,直至parent的右节点==node节点,那么parent就是node的前继节点 算法实现 /// 找到node的前继节点publicstaticNodegetPerviousNode(Node node){if(node==null){returnnode;}if(node.left!=null)...
解析 正确 单链表的节点仅包含指向后继节点的指针,因此只能向后访问,无法直接获取前驱节点。双链表的节点包含指向前驱和后继的指针,允许从当前节点向前或向后遍历,从而能够访问链表中所有节点。题目对各特性的描述均符合单链表和双链表的定义,因此结论正确。
《Nature Communications》丨12公里量子中继节点,刷新多项世界纪录! 多模复用的量子中继架构。通过依次激发70个独立可寻址的空间阵列存储器单元,产生280个时分(time-bin)光子模式。光子模式通过波长转换装置转换为通讯波段,在经过12公里光纤传...
自动或手动更新订阅后,V2N能继续使用更新订阅前在使用中的节点(我用的是6.43) 描述你所考虑的替代方案 No response 我确认已查询历史issues 是 wyjtm added the enhancement label May 25, 2024 Owner 2dust commented May 29, 2024 如果节点没有变化,会自动选中以前的节点;如果变化了就默认第一个 设置找...
BSTNode*node = search(root, val);//找到该值的节点if(!node)returnnullptr;//有左子,则以左子为根的最大节点为当前节点的前驱if(node->left)returnmaxkeynode(node->left);//无左子:(1)为右子,则其前驱为其父节点;//(2)为左子,则查找"x的最低的父结点,并且该父结点要具有右孩子",找到的这个"...
百度试题 结果1 题目在深度优先搜索第5步中,扩展节点n后其后继节点放入OPEN表的: A. 前端 B. 末端 C. 最中间 D. 随机一个位置 相关知识点: 试题来源: 解析 A 反馈 收藏
【题文】“十四五”时期是承前启后、继往开来的关键时间节点,中国的新发展阶段即将开启。在中国共产党第十九届中央委员会第五次全体会议上通过的“十四五”规划和2035年远景目标